Quick primer before the weekly sync: the Matchbright pairing service runs on a JVM, and GC pauses over 200ms cause match timeouts that look like network flakiness. We moved to a low-pause collector last quarter, but large batch imports still trigger long pauses. If the pause-time graph spikes, check for imports first. Tuning flags and the pause dashboard are linked on the internal page below.

operations page: https://vault.qirvanhq.local/ticket

Subject: Handover — ValiForge plugin releases

Hey Marta,

Taking off Friday, so here's the short version: the validator plugin registry for ValiForge ships every other Tuesday. Third-party validators get sandboxed automatically, so don't stress about the new date-format plugin. Just run the pre-release checklist and tag the build. You'll need the signing key for the registry upload, which is:

rollout seal: bky4_DFM9

Handover note — Crumbwheel order cutoffs.

Welcome aboard. The bakery cutoff rule in Crumbwheel closes same-day orders at 14:00 local to each storefront, not UTC — this has bitten us twice. Holiday overrides live in the calendar service and take precedence silently, so always check there first when a cutoff looks wrong. To unlock the calendar service's admin console after a restart, enter the recovery passphrase below.

vault phrase of bagap-bahaf = silion-pelox-sorox-casdor-quenwyn-fraax-eliox-praael-kelion-quenvan-kasox-rusael-norius-belvan

Hi — welcome to Gridlock Words on-call. The crossword generator occasionally wedges on themed puzzles with long seed words; the fix is restarting the solver pod, not the whole stack. Pages are rare, maybe one a week. Alerts route through the usual channel. Triage steps and escalation order are on the page below.

runbook for badug-kadup: https://confluence.zemvarlabs.internal/projects/browse/display/projects/bd1b

MEMO — Kettling Depot Receiving

Uniform sets for the new Kettling depot arrive Wednesday via Ashgrove courier: 40 boxes, sorted by size, manifest attached to box one. Check the count at the dock before signing; shortages go straight to stores, not the courier. The hand-over instruction the courier will follow is set out below.

drop instructions, tafof-baguf: the holmir gilox courier leaves the sormir ulaok holdor ledger at gate 5596 under passcode 257343